Company Group Securities definition

Company Group Securities means (i) Corporation Securities, (ii) Utility Securities (other than Utility Securities held by the Corporation), and (iii) any other interests of a member of the Company Group designated as stock by the Board as disclosed in a United States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) filing by the Corporation.
Company Group Securities has the meaning set forth in Section 3.2.2(c).
